Effect of β 4 -subunit on TCF and SRE-dependent transcription. <t>(A)</t> <t>Luciferase</t> activity measured in TCF + /Wnt3 + /FZD7 + , TCF + , and TCF − cells expressing eGFP (black bars) or β 4 -eGFP (gray bars). (B) copGFP fluorescence measured in TCF + /Wnt3 + /FZD7 + , TCF + , and TCF − cells expressing pcDNA (black bars) or β 4 -myc (gray bars). Luciferase and copGFP activity were normalized to the value measured in TCF + /Wnt3 + /FZD7 + cells expressing eGFP (A) or pcDNA (B). Experiments were done in triplicate with n = 3. (C) Luciferase activity measured in HCC cells expressing SRE reporter gene system, <t>pTK-RL</t> vector, and eGFP (black bars) or β 4 -eGFP (gray bars). SRE-dependent luciferase activity was normalized to Renilla luciferase activity ( n = 2). Transfected HCC cells were maintained in serum-free medium (− serum). Serum (10% final concentration) was added 4 h before luciferase measurement (+ serum). NS, nonsignificant; *, p ≤ 0.05; ****, p ≤ 0.0001.

Predominant expression of CML66-L in tumor cells resulted from tumor-specific transcription of CML66-L promoter. A, The schematic representation of CML66-L-specific promoter (1.8 kb) and CML66-S promoter (2.6 kb). Several transcription factor binding sites and their positions are marked on the CML66-L promoter and CML66-S promoter, respectively. B, Constructs of CML66-L promoter and CML66-S promoter in both sense and antisense orientations on the <t>pGL-3</t> <t>luciferase</t> enhancer reporter vector. CML66-L promoter antisense and CML66-S promoter antisense were also constructed as controls, because it is well accepted that promoter activities are orientation dependent. C, CML66-L and CML66-S promoter activities in Hela cells. The mean ratios of firefly luciferase activities conferred by reporter constructs vs <t>Renilla</t> luciferase activities (internal control) and 2 SD are shown as relative luciferase activities for every experimental group. The error bars indicating the upper limit in all the groups, except CML66-L promoter sense orientation, are hardly visible due to the scale. The experiments were repeated four times, and the representative results are shown. Notably, similar results were obtained in HCCT, a hepatic carcinoma cell line, after transfection with the same sets of reporter luciferase vectors (not shown). D, CML66-L and CML66-S promoter activities in NTERA-2 cl.D1 human testicular embryonal carcinoma cells. The mean ratios of firefly luciferase activities conferred by reporter constructs vs Renilla luciferase activities (internal control) and 2 SD are shown as relative luciferase activities for every experimental group. The error bars indicating the upper limit in all the groups, except CML66-L promoter sense orientation construct and CML66-S promoter sense orientation construct, are hardly visible due to the scale. The experiments were repeated four times, and the representative results are shown.
